BRITISH LIBERALS

LONDON. Feb. 11. The Liberal Council has been formally constituted. Lord Gladstone, on rising to (impose liard Grey as President, received a tremendous ovation. The Yiee-Presidents include Lords Gladstone. Buckmh.ster. Sir Henry Limn, Professor Gflliert Murray, and Hon. Air Runeimau. The Committee include Sir Donald ALicLean. Air Yivian Phillips. Air Pringle, Lord Stanley anil Air Alderlev. Lord Grey, in his presidential speech, expressed the opinion that, while the British troops in China were used only to protect life, land not to enforce obsolete treaties, there was no complaint against the Government,
